












Lenovo EA390 OWS True Wireless Earbuds
Lenovo EA390 OWS True Wireless Earbuds is an upcoming Wireless Open Ear TWS Earbuds. It has a 12 mm Titanium Diaphragm Dynamic Coil Unit driver. It offers up to 5 hours per earbud and 24 hours total with case battery life. Notable features include Microphone.
